      <content:encoded xmlns="http://purl.org/rss/1.0/modules/content/"><![CDATA[<p><strong>Field Marshal Syed Asim Munir on Saturday delivered a strong message to India, warning that Pakistan will defend its sovereignty at all costs and is fully prepared to respond to any aggression.</strong></p>
<p>Speaking at the passing-out parade at PNS Rahbar, the army chief said India displayed “blatant hostility”, which Pakistan answered with both strength and restraint.</p>
<p>“India carried out unjustified attacks against Pakistan. On both occasions, we gave a firm and effective response, preventing the situation from escalating into a larger regional conflict,” he said.</p>
<p>Field Marshal Asim Munir reaffirmed that Pakistan’s sovereignty is non-negotiable, and any attempt to challenge it will invite consequences.</p>
<p>“We prioritize peace but will never compromise on our national interests. The enemy must not mistake our patience for weakness.”</p>
<p>“If our enemy believes we will tolerate violations of our sovereignty, they are gravely mistaken,” he stated.</p>
<p>“If the enemy thinks that Pakistan is weak or will not respond, then they are seriously mistaken,” he added.</p>
<p>He also said that India wanted to gain political benefits from its military power, nationalism, and fake strategic importance. Our enemy is constantly demonstrating arrogant and aggressive behaviour, he added.</p>
<p>“Our adversary continues to show arrogance and aggression,” he stated. “However, our national spirit has only grown stronger in times of adversity, and our armed forces remain vigilant and prepared.”</p>
<h2><a id="call-for-maritime-strength-and-regional-peace" href="#call-for-maritime-strength-and-regional-peace" class="heading-permalink" aria-hidden="true" title="Permalink"></a>Call for maritime strength and regional peace</h2>
<p>Field Marshal Asim Munir emphasized the importance of enhancing Pakistan’s maritime capabilities in the face of rapidly evolving naval warfare.</p>
<p>“We must maintain a strong and effective maritime force. The sea domain is transforming, and Pakistan cannot afford to lag behind,” he told the cadets.</p>
<p>He congratulated cadets from friendly countries — Turkey, Bahrain, Iraq, Palestine, and Djibouti — commending the high standards and professionalism of the Naval Academy.</p>
<p>The exemplary turnout and enthusiastic attitude of the cadets at the parade is a testament to the high standards of the Naval Academy. The award-winning cadets deserved special praise for their outstanding achievements, he added.</p>
<h2><a id="kashmir-and-the-fight-against-terrorism" href="#kashmir-and-the-fight-against-terrorism" class="heading-permalink" aria-hidden="true" title="Permalink"></a>Kashmir and the fight against terrorism</h2>
<p>Turning to regional issues, the army chief reiterated Pakistan’s support for the people of Indian-occupied Kashmir, calling their struggle “legitimate and lawful,”.</p>
<p>“India’s illegal occupation must end. Sustainable peace in South Asia is not possible without a just resolution of the Kashmir dispute in line with UN Security Council resolutions,” he asserted.</p>
<p>The oppressive government of India can never dampen the courage and morale of the Kashmiris. Pakistan will continue to support the Kashmiris politically, diplomatically and morally, he stated.</p>
<p>On domestic security, Field Marshal Asim Munir expressed confidence in Pakistan’s ongoing counter-terrorism efforts.</p>
<p>“We are on the verge of complete success in the war against terrorism. India, however, is deliberately creating tensions in the region,” he stated.</p>
